How to Turn Off the Narrator on Your Vizio TV
Turning off the narrator on your Vizio TV is a relatively simple process. Here are the steps:
Method 1: Using the TV’s Settings Menu
- Press the “Menu” button on your Vizio TV remote control.
- Navigate to the “System” or “Settings” menu.
- Scroll down to the “Accessibility” or “Audio” section.
- Look for the “Video Description” or “Audio Description” option.
- Select it and toggle it to the “Off” position.
Alternative Method: Using the TV’s Quick Settings Menu
If you’re using a newer Vizio TV model, you might be able to access the narrator settings through the Quick Settings menu. To do this:
- Press the “OK” button on your remote control to open the Quick Settings menu.
- Navigate to the “Audio” or “Accessibility” section.
- Look for the “Video Description” or “Audio Description” option.
- Select it and toggle it to the “Off” position.

What is the Narrator feature on my Vizio TV?
The Narrator feature on your Vizio TV is a voice guide that provides an audible description of the on-screen menus, settings, and other visual elements. This feature is designed to assist visually impaired users in navigating the TV’s interface. However, some users may find it annoying or unnecessary, which is why they may want to turn it off.
The Narrator feature can be useful for those who need assistance, but for others, it can be distracting. If you’re not using this feature, it’s a good idea to turn it off to avoid any unnecessary voiceovers while watching your favorite shows or movies.

How do I turn off the Narrator on my Vizio TV using the remote control?
To turn off the Narrator on your Vizio TV using the remote control, press the “Menu” button and navigate to the “Settings” or “System” menu. From there, select “Accessibility” or “Audio” and look for the “Narrator” or “Voice Guide” option. Select this option and choose “Off” or “Disable” to turn off the Narrator.
Make sure to save your changes before exiting the settings menu. If you’re not sure where to find the Narrator option, you can refer to your TV’s user manual or contact Vizio’s customer support for assistance.

Can I turn off the Narrator on my Vizio TV for specific apps only?
Unfortunately, you cannot turn off the Narrator on your Vizio TV for specific apps only. The Narrator feature is a global setting that applies to all apps and menus on the TV. If you want to turn off the Narrator, you’ll need to do so for all apps and menus.
However, some apps may have their own settings for voice guides or audio descriptions. You can check the app’s settings menu to see if there are any options to disable voice guides or audio descriptions.
